Excerpt from The Baddington Peerage, Vol. 2 of 3: Who Won, and Who Wore It, a Story of the Best and the Worst Society Philip Leslie indeed (under which name the poor devil of a painter whom I have heretofore occasionally designated under the embarrassing cognomen of the Unknown will be henceforward recognised in this story), possessed a character and disposition, and was gifted with qualities and attributes, de serving minuter, more extended, and more careful notice, than is usually allotted to the hero of a romance. Of his outward guise I have not felt bound to say much, but as regards those inner traits which my power of divination as a story-teller privileges me to foresee and to foreknow, it behoves me to be less concise and more explicit. Bear with me, then, while I endeavour to place before you the man - not in his habit as he lived, for outward garments are but sorry guides, and afford but an Insufficient key to character.
